GNDU Amritsar B.Sc M.Sc Physics FAQs
Ques. What is the B.Sc M.Sc Physics FYIP at GNDU Amritsar?
Ans. The 5-year integrated B.Sc and M.Sc in Physics at GNDU Amritsar is a Five Year Integrated Programme (FYIP) that combines undergraduate and postgraduate study in a single continuum. Students complete 3 years of B.Sc-level coursework followed by 2 years of M.Sc-level specialisation in advanced physics, quantum mechanics, and research methodology. The programme awards an M.Sc Physics degree on completion.
Ques. What is the total fee for B.Sc M.Sc Physics at GNDU?
Ans. The total fee for the 5-year Physics FYIP at GNDU Amritsar is INR 2,78,775, payable at INR 55,755 per year. Examination fees are charged separately each semester. SC/ST Punjab domicile students may apply for post-matric scholarships through punjabscholarships.gov.in.
Ques. What subjects are covered in the Physics FYIP at GNDU?
Ans. The integrated Physics FYIP at GNDU covers classical mechanics, thermodynamics, electrodynamics, quantum mechanics, solid-state physics, nuclear and particle physics, optics, electronics, and advanced research methods in physics. Practical training includes spectroscopy, electronics labs, and project work in the advanced physics department laboratories.
Ques. What are career options after M.Sc Physics FYIP from GNDU Amritsar?
Ans. Graduates of the M.Sc Physics FYIP from GNDU Amritsar can pursue careers as research scientists at CSIR, DRDO, and ISRO, or as physics lecturers at colleges and universities. Many graduates appear for CSIR-NET Physical Sciences or GATE for PhD admissions at IISc, IITs, and national science institutes. IT and data analytics firms also recruit physics graduates for analytical roles.
Ques. How does the B.Sc M.Sc Physics FYIP differ from a standalone M.Sc Physics?
Ans. The 5-year FYIP admits students directly after 10+2 and integrates B.Sc and M.Sc coursework in a continuous programme, awarding an M.Sc degree at the end. The standalone 2-year M.Sc Physics admits graduates with a B.Sc degree. The FYIP is suited for students committed to physics from the beginning, while the 2-year M.Sc suits those who decide on specialisation after completing a general science undergraduate degree.
Ques. Can B.Sc M.Sc Physics FYIP graduates apply for PhD at GNDU?
Ans. Yes. M.Sc Physics from GNDU FYIP is equivalent to a regular M.Sc and qualifies graduates for PhD admission at GNDU Amritsar and other central and state universities. Qualifying CSIR-NET Physical Sciences or GATE is required for PhD fellowship and admission at premier institutes.
